NotesFAQContact Us
Collection
Advanced
Search Tips
Showing 1 to 15 of 16 results Save | Export
Peer reviewed Peer reviewed
Wilson, R. N.; McCrum, E. – Computers and Education, 1984
Discusses difficulties of producing computer assisted learning (CAL) software economically. Proposed as a solution, modular programing is illustrated by describing production of a matrix algebra package. Use of special CAL modules and facilities provided by subroutine libraries are cited, and development of a package to teach matrix theory is…
Descriptors: Algorithms, Case Studies, Computer Assisted Instruction, Cost Effectiveness
Peer reviewed Peer reviewed
Goldberg, Adele – Computers and Education, 1979
Proposes a programing design curriculum based on three conceptual areas: process, symbolic representation, and methods of interpretation; and describes computer games and simulations in which design skills of simple and conditional sequencing, rule or constraint specification, hypothesis testing, and modeling are employed. (Author/CMV)
Descriptors: Algorithms, Computer Assisted Instruction, Computer Science Education, Computer Software
Peer reviewed Peer reviewed
Boero, P.; And Others – Computers and Education, 1982
Describes a method for integrating basic instruction on computer programing in mathematics courses for earth science, chemistry, and pharmaceutical chemistry students to provide them with a knowledge of the real possibilities of computing media. (CHC)
Descriptors: Computer Assisted Instruction, Curriculum Development, Educational Innovation, Foreign Countries
Peer reviewed Peer reviewed
Jackson, David – Computers and Education, 1991
Argues that advent of computer-aided instruction (CAI) systems for teaching introductory computer programing makes it imperative that software be developed to automate assessment and grading of student programs. Examples of typical student programing problems are given, and application of the Unix tools Lex and Yacc to the automatic assessment of…
Descriptors: Computer Assisted Instruction, Computer Software, Computer System Design, Grading
Peer reviewed Peer reviewed
Bramer, M. A. – Computers and Education, 1982
The programing language described was designed to remedy the weaknesses of BASIC by adding structured constructs and other desirable improvements, while retaining the major features and overall spirit of BASIC. COMAL 80 (COMmon ALgorithmic language), developed in Denmark, is proposed as an introductory programing language for schools. (Five…
Descriptors: Computer Assisted Instruction, Computer Programs, Computer Science, Educational Strategies
Peer reviewed Peer reviewed
Johnson, Brian L.; And Others – Computers and Education, 1990
Discusses the teaching consultant process in computer programing courses, describes a teaching consultant model from both the teachers' and students' perspectives, and shows how this model can be used to develop an intelligent teaching consultant (ITC). Differences between this collection of expert systems and conventional intelligent tutoring…
Descriptors: Computer Assisted Instruction, Computer Science Education, Computer System Design, Expert Systems
Peer reviewed Peer reviewed
Bottino, Rosa Maria – Computers and Education, 1992
Reports results of two studies that compared the introduction of procedural (exemplified by Pascal) and declarative (exemplified by Prolog) programing languages to Italian secondary school students. Discussion covers learning approaches and problems, mental models, programing techniques, programing environments, and educational applications. (27…
Descriptors: Comparative Analysis, Computer Assisted Instruction, Computer Science Education, Foreign Countries
Peer reviewed Peer reviewed
Tomek, Ivan – Computers and Education, 1982
Describes "Josef," a robot programing language similar to the LOGO turtle language, which has been designed as an instructional system through which the algorithmic problem-solving skills required in computer programing can be developed and tested in a controlled learning environment. Four figures and a reference list are included. (JL)
Descriptors: Algorithms, Computer Assisted Instruction, Computer Science Education, Higher Education
Peer reviewed Peer reviewed
Kidd, Marilyn E.; Holmes, Glyn – Computers and Education, 1982
Discusses the impact of the presentation of data on the educational effectiveness of computer assisted learning systems, describes some of the existing systems for controlling the display of instructional data on CRTs, and outlines a project undertaken at the University of Western Ontario to exploit the capabilities of microcomputer color…
Descriptors: Color, Computer Assisted Instruction, Computer Graphics, Computer Programs
Peer reviewed Peer reviewed
Norris, A. C. – Computers and Education, 1979
Discusses the design of computational exercises useful for a course in numerical methods for chemists. Some of the exercises make use of available programs while others require the student to write programs incorporating numerical routines. The emphasis throughout is on the use of numerical methods to solve chemical problems. (Author)
Descriptors: Chemistry, Computer Assisted Instruction, Computer Software, Instructional Design
Peer reviewed Peer reviewed
Hung, Sheung-Lun; And Others – Computers and Education, 1993
Discusses software metrics and describes a study of graduate students in Hong Kong that evaluated the relevance of using software metrics as a means of assessing students' performance in programing. The use of four basic metrics to measure programing skill, complexity, programing style, and programing efficiency using Pascal is examined. (13…
Descriptors: Academic Achievement, Computer Assisted Instruction, Computer Software, Evaluation Methods
Peer reviewed Peer reviewed
Van Hees, E. J. W. M. – Computers and Education, 1982
Discusses computer managed learning (CML), both as part of an innovative educational strategy and as a means to support the classroom teacher, and argues that introduction of the computer in support of education can best be started at the bottom, i.e., with simple administrative tasks. One such introduction is described. (Author/JL)
Descriptors: Computer Assisted Instruction, Computer Managed Instruction, Computer Oriented Programs, Design Requirements
Peer reviewed Peer reviewed
Boyd, G. M.; And Others – Computers and Education, 1984
Describes two studies which examined crucial factors in learner support for computer-assisted learning. Douglas investigated the effectiveness of a computerized learner support system with a group of college students, while Lebel used 15- to 17-year-old mathematics students to study the sociostructure (who works with whom and under what social…
Descriptors: Competition, Computer Assisted Instruction, Educational Research, Higher Education
Peer reviewed Peer reviewed
Borne, Isabelle; Girardot, Colette – Computers and Education, 1991
Describes the use of Smalltalk-80, a French programing language, to teach young children to program effectively using object-oriented concepts. Learning processes involving problem solving and programing are examined, the object-oriented environment is discussed, teacher training is described, and future work is suggested. (21 references) (LRW)
Descriptors: Computer Assisted Instruction, Computer Simulation, Curriculum Development, Elementary Education
Peer reviewed Peer reviewed
Herrmann, Robert W. – Computers and Education, 1989
Discusses results of a survey of Virginia's public high schools that was conducted to determine the progress that had been made in integrating computers into the classroom based on the 1984 guidelines released by the Virginia Department of Education. Difficulties with hardware and software, teacher characteristics, and teacher training are…
Descriptors: Computer Assisted Instruction, Computer Science Education, Courseware, Guidelines
Previous Page | Next Page ยป
Pages: 1  |  2